Programme Overview
The Advanced Certificate in Time Series Analysis for Environmental Sciences is designed for professionals and students in environmental science, data analysts, and researchers who are interested in leveraging advanced statistical techniques to analyze environmental data. This program equips learners with comprehensive skills in time series analysis, focusing on the application of these techniques to environmental datasets. Learners will gain expertise in forecasting models, seasonal adjustments, and the analysis of trends in environmental data, enabling them to make informed decisions based on robust data analysis.
Key skills and knowledge developed through this program include the ability to apply various time series models such as ARIMA, exponential smoothing, and seasonal decomposition methods. Students will learn to use advanced software tools and programming languages like R, Python, and specialized environmental data analysis software. The curriculum emphasizes the interpretation of results, validation of models, and the integration of time series analysis into environmental management practices.

Why This Course
Enhance Career Prospects: Professionals in environmental science can significantly improve their job prospects by obtaining an Advanced Certificate in Time Series Analysis for Environmental Data. This certification equips them with advanced statistical skills necessary for analyzing environmental trends, such as climate change impacts or pollution levels over time. For instance, environmental consultants can use time series analysis to predict future environmental conditions, aiding in policy development and resource management.
Develop Expertise in Environmental Data Analysis: The certificate provides in-depth knowledge of time series analysis techniques specifically tailored for environmental datasets. This includes understanding seasonal patterns, trends, and autocorrelation, which are crucial for accurate data interpretation. For example, a hydrologist can use these skills to analyze river flow data, identifying long-term changes that inform water resource management strategies.
